Shooting in Escondido driveway leaves 1 victim injured

Escondido police are investigating after a man standing in a driveway was shot in the leg by someone in a vehicle that then drove off early Sunday, police said.

The shooting was reported around 1:40 a.m. at a home on South Citrus Avenue near Mountain View Drive on the east side of the city. Witnesses told police a white SUV pulled up to the home and someone in the vehicle fired several shots, striking a man standing in the driveway in the thigh, said Escondido police Lt. Joshua Langdon.

The victim — a man in his 40s — was treated for injuries not considered life threatening, he said.

Officers located two bullets at the scene. Witnesses said three or four shots were fired. No one got out of the vehicle.

The suspect was last seen as the SUV drove away from the home, heading north on Citrus. No suspect description was released.
